> Which canon Gospel is that in?  Both Matthew and Luke say that the
> couple traveled from Nazareth to Bethlehem.

Only Luke has the taxation/census story. Matthew states that Jesus was
born in Bethlehem without mentioning any preceding journey (Mt 2:1). He
has the family settling in Nazareth once they return from Egypt, but it
sounds like that is the first time that Joseph comes to that city (Mt
2:22-23). 

The contradiction is not as clear as I remembered it, though.
